Re: NSGr.20 Fw 190D loss

My notes from the IWM's microfilms of the Gen.Quartiermeister 6. Abteilung loss records also have Fw 190 G-3, WNr. 160693 of 3./NSG 20 100% damaged at Diepenheim on 12 March 1945, Cause: crash following engine failure.

Never seen a single mention in any wartime source of a D-9 with this outfit.
